Market Overview
The global total wrist replacement market is witnessing significant growth and is expected to continue its upward trajectory in the coming years. Total wrist replacement, also known as total wrist arthroplasty, is a surgical procedure that involves replacing a damaged wrist joint with an artificial implant. This procedure is typically performed to relieve pain and restore function in individuals with severe wrist arthritis or other debilitating wrist conditions.
Meaning
Total wrist replacement surgery is a complex procedure that requires expertise in orthopedic surgery. It is often recommended when conservative treatments, such as medication and physical therapy, fail to provide adequate relief. The goal of total wrist replacement is to improve the patient’s quality of life by reducing pain, increasing mobility, and restoring wrist function.

Market Restraints
Despite the positive market drivers, there are certain factors that may restrain the growth of the global total wrist replacement market. Firstly, the high cost of total wrist replacement procedures may limit access for some patients, particularly in regions with limited healthcare resources or inadequate insurance coverage.
Moreover, the complexity of the surgical procedure and the specialized training required for surgeons may pose challenges to market growth. The availability of skilled orthopedic surgeons proficient in performing total wrist replacement surgeries could be a limiting factor, especially in certain geographical areas.
Additionally, the potential risks and complications associated with total wrist replacement surgery, such as infection, implant failure, and limited lifespan of the implants, could also deter some patients from opting for this procedure.

Category-wise Insights
Modular Total Wrist Replacement Systems: Modular total wrist replacement systems offer several advantages, including better implant fit, improved range of motion, and increased flexibility for the surgeon in adapting to individual patient anatomy. These systems allow for customized implantation based on patient-specific requirements, resulting in enhanced surgical outcomes.
Non-Modular Total Wrist Replacement Systems: Non-modular total wrist replacement systems are designed as a one-piece implant and provide a simplified surgical technique. These systems offer ease of use for the surgeon and are often preferred in cases where a more straightforward implantation process is desired.

Covid-19 Impact
The COVID-19 pandemic has had a significant impact on the global healthcare industry, including the total wrist replacement market. During the initial stages of the pandemic, non-emergency elective surgeries, including total wrist replacement procedures, were postponed or canceled to prioritize resources for COVID-19 patients.
However, as the healthcare systems adapted to the new normal, elective surgeries gradually resumed. The backlog of postponed procedures, combined with the increasing demand for total wrist replacement surgeries, resulted in a surge in the number of procedures performed once restrictions were lifted.
Furthermore, the pandemic has accelerated the adoption of telemedicine and virtual consultations, allowing healthcare professionals to assess and provide initial guidance to patients remotely. Telemedicine has played a crucial role in facilitating patient consultations, preoperative evaluations, and postoperative follow-ups during times when in-person visits were restricted.
The pandemic has also highlighted the importance of infection control measures in healthcare settings. Strict adherence to protocols and guidelines, including thorough sterilization of surgical instruments and maintaining a clean surgical environment, has become even more crucial to minimize the risk of postoperative complications.
